I've got a test environment with users in 2 Domains, HBEU and HBAP on Active Directory. When users in the HBEU domain try to log on to Access Point they get the following pop-up:
It doesn't even work if they enter their credentials in the above pop-up. However HBAP users can get on to Access Point without issues (no pop-up).
I've had a look in the Directory Service Connector logs and found the following several times:
Warning Search: no match for qualifier HBAP found among resources
I've checked the set-up in QMC and it matches our other services which are running fine for both groups of users.
As anyone got any suggestions on how to resolve? Or what the issue might be exactly?

The issue has been fixed now. I'm told it was that "IIS Authentication Issue", some some clever person had a DENY USERS rule in it.
